Selected publications
1) Briot, J.-P., From artificial neural networks to deep learning for music generation - History, concepts and trends, Neural Computing and Applications (NCAA), Special issue Neural networks in Art, sound and Design, (33):39-65, January 2021.
2) Briot, J.-P., Hadjeres, G. and Pachet, F.-D., Deep Learning Techniques for Music Generation, Computational Synthesis and Creative Systems Series, Springer Verlag, 2020.
3) Briot, J.-P., IA et dé-coïncidence créative, In Patrick Albert, editor, Intelligence artificielle et dé-coïncidence, Collection Libres opinions, pp 32-52, Presses des Mines, June 2025.
4) Fradet, N., Gutowski, N., Chhel, F. and Briot, J.-P., Byte pair encoding for symbolic music, In Houda Bouamor, Juan Pino, and Kalika Bali, editors, Proceedings of the 2023 Conference on Empirical Methods in Natural Language Processing (EMNLP 2023), pp. 2001-2020, Singapore, December 2023.
5) Douwes, C., Bindi, G., Caillon, A., Esling, P. and Briot, J.-P., Is quality enough? Integrating Energy Consumption in a Large-Scale Evaluation of Neural Audio Synthesis Models, 2023 IEEE International Conference on Acoustics, Speech, and Signal Processing (ICASSP 2023), Rhodes Island, Greece, June 2023.
6) Briot, J.-P., From Procedures, Objects, Actors, Components, Services, to Agents - A Comparative Analysis of the History and Evolution of Programming Abstractions, In Bertrand Meyer, editor, The French School of Programming, pp. 125-146, Springer Verlag, March 2024.
7) Alvarez, A., Zaleski, L., Briot, J.-P. and Irving, M.A., Collective management of environmental commons with multiple usages: a guaranteed viability approach, Ecological Modelling, Vol. 475, Article 110186, January 2023.
